What the role involves
- This is a permanent role supporting the Group Head of Compliance across a range of activities including.
- Managing the Compliance inbox, ensuring queries are prioritised and directed to the appropriate individuals within agreed timeframes.
- Developing and implementing anti-bribery and corruption (ABC) compliance programmes and policies.
- Provide actionable recommendations to mitigate compliance risks.
- Assisting with the KYC and onboarding which includes individuals and market counterparties for bond trading.
- Responding to business queries on compliance-related matters.
Skills and requirements
- Bachelor’s degree with an outstanding academic record from a reputable university.
- Experience: 3–7+ years in compliance within financial services, with specific experience in capital markets or asset management preferred.
- Knowledge: Strong understanding of regulatory frameworks such as MIFID II, MAR, IFPR, and FCA rules.
- The ability to work accurately and efficiently under tight deadlines.
